Tax write offs

I had a schedule C business last year where I included write offs for my office space. However, that business will have no activity this year.   Instead we have used that office space this year for performing business for our LLC Partnership.  Is it appropriate to switch the write off that way and what is the best way to include this deduction in the LLC Partnership return?

Tax write offs

Hi 7evin337557,

 

This is great question and thank you for asking!  If you stopped using your home office for one company and started using it for another, you can switch the deduction from one company to another.  The important thing is it is dedicated office space to run your company.    You can also share office space between multiple business; however you can only take the deduction once.

When it comes to the Partnership return, you will split the revenue and expenses between partners using Form 1065.   When you complete Form 1065 a K-1 will be generated which will allow you to add your share of the revenue and deductions to your own tax return.  Here is another link for the Form 1065:
